The reason for the prosperity of the Tang Dynasty

There were many reasons for the prosperity of the Tang Dynasty. In terms of politics, the rulers worked hard and their policies were open. The foundation laid by the Sui Dynasty provided certain conditions for the development of the Tang Dynasty. Rulers won the hearts of the people and adopted a series of effective governance measures, such as Li Shimin, Emperor Taizong of the Tang Dynasty, who established the system of three provinces and six departments and adopted the imperial examination to select talents; Wu Zetian increased the number of people admitted to the imperial examination and created the military examination and palace examination; Li Longji, Emperor Xuanzong of the Tang Dynasty, appointed high officials to preside over the imperial examination and improve the status of the imperial examination. At the same time, the ruler appointed the wise and cut down the redundant personnel. Moreover, the Tang Dynasty rulers were open to foreign policies and treated everyone equally. For example, Emperor Taizong of the Tang Dynasty proposed that " since ancient times, China has been valued and foreigners despised. I love them all." This attitude was deeply loved and respected by the people of neighboring countries and promoted foreign exchanges. In terms of economy, the Tang Dynasty began to levy tea taxes, promote rice cultivation, invent and apply new agricultural tools, improve silk technology, prosper foreign trade, and divide cities into east and west markets. From a social perspective, there was a culture of learning in society, and the widespread implementation of the imperial examination system also provided talent support for the development of the Tang Dynasty. In addition, the long period of turmoil before the Tang Dynasty made people's desire for unification strong. The unification of the Tang Dynasty was what everyone hoped for. Although the Wei, Jin, and Southern and Northern Dynasties were turbulent, they also erupted with vitality. The Sui Dynasty laid the foundation for the Tang Dynasty's business. For example, the construction of the Beijing-Hangzhou Grand Canal boosted the economic development at that time and created the foundation for the subsequent development of the Tang Dynasty. The Tang Dynasty inherited the system of the Sui Dynasty and relied on the many infrastructure established by the Sui Dynasty to develop. What is the reason for the prosperity of Han Fu?

Han Fu was an important form of ancient Chinese literature that flourished in the Han Dynasty. The main reasons for its prosperity were as follows: 1. The influence of traditional thinking: Han Fu was originally influenced by Confucianism and emphasized morality, ethics, and political thinking. In the Han Dynasty, Confucianism became the official philosophy, and Han Fu also reflected this kind of ideology. 2. The influence of literary form: The structure of Han Fu is more complicated, including prose, poetry and Fu. Among them, Fu is the most representative and popular one. The forms of Han Fu were varied, some were lyrical, some were narrative, and some were argumentative. They had distinct characteristics. 3. The influence of culture and art: The Han Dynasty was a period of prosperity in Chinese history, and Han Fu also reflected the prosperity of this culture. The cultural arts of the Han Dynasty, including music, dance, painting, calligraphy, and other artistic elements, were also integrated into Han Fu to form a unique artistic style. 4. The influence of social atmosphere: Han Dynasty was a period of social unrest. Wars, natural disasters and other social problems occurred frequently, and Han Fu reflected this social atmosphere more. Han Fu was full of dissatisfaction with social reality and exploration of life destiny, reflecting the wishes and aspirations of the people at that time. The prosperity of Han Fu was the result of many factors, including traditional ideas, literary forms, culture and art, and social atmosphere. Han Fu not only reflected the political, cultural and social life of the Han Dynasty, but also had a profound impact on the literature and art of later generations.

The reason for the economic prosperity of the Song Dynasty

The Song Dynasty was one of the most prosperous periods in ancient China history. Its economic achievements were the result of many factors. The following are some of the main reasons: - ** The economic recovery and development of the Sui and Tang Dynasties **: After the Sui and Tang Dynasties were reunified, a series of economic recovery measures were taken, laying the foundation for the economic development of the Song Dynasty. - New changes in the economic system in many aspects, such as the further development of private ownership of land and renting system, the establishment of market system in urban management, etc. - ** The mechanism and concept of mutual benefit between the government and the people **: Through the business tax system, the income of merchants will be converted into the national finance, and the development of business will benefit both the government and the people. - ** Integration of cities and villages **: In the Song Dynasty, the urban market system was generally established, and the ban on night markets was gradually abolished. There were no longer any restrictions on economic activities and the behavior of residents. - The development of commerce promoted the change of production structure and the commoditization of agriculture. For example, Jiangnan became the main production area of grain, and Zhejiang, Fujian, and Sichuan were the production centers of books and silk. - ** Relatively open overseas trade policy **: The Song Dynasty allowed and encouraged its people to engage in overseas trade, realizing the shift of the center of foreign trade in ancient China from the northwest land route to the southeast sea route. The economic prosperity of the Song Dynasty was not only reflected in the development of domestic trade, but also in the expansion of foreign trade. Through the establishment of the Shi Bo Si to manage overseas trade, the Song Dynasty's economic ties with the world became closer. The prosperity of overseas trade not only increased the country's financial revenue, but also promoted the activity of the domestic market and the development of the commodity economy. At the same time, the mutual promotion of agriculture, craftsmanship, and commerce made the entire country's economic system more complete and powerful.
